H&K VP9 Review: Precision, Comfort, and Reliability in One Striker-Fired Package

The Heckler & Koch VP9 is a full-size, striker-fired, semi-automatic pistol chambered in 9×19mm Parabellum. Introduced in 2014, the VP9 marked HK’s return to striker-fired systems after decades of focusing on hammer-fired models like the USP and P30.

Designed with a polymer frame, steel slide, and a cold hammer-forged polygonal barrel, it emphasizes ergonomics, modularity, and accuracy. The VP9’s interchangeable backstraps and side panels allow over 20 grip configurations, and its fully ambidextrous controls make it ideal for both left- and right-handed shooters.

Its refined trigger system and consistent reliability have earned it a reputation as one of the finest factory striker-fired pistols in its class.

Why is the H&K VP9 such a major step forward for Heckler & Koch?

The VP9 (short for Volkspistole 9mm or “People’s Pistol”) represented a pivotal shift for Heckler & Koch when it launched in 2014. After years of success with the hammer-fired USP, P2000, and P30 series, HK recognized the growing dominance of striker-fired handguns like the Glock 17 and Smith & Wesson M&P.

The VP9 was HK’s answer—a pistol engineered to deliver the same German precision and reliability, but with a striker-fired action optimized for law enforcement, military, and civilian shooters seeking a crisp, modern trigger system.

Heckler & Koch GmbH, headquartered in Oberndorf, Germany, has long been synonymous with durability and performance. The company’s commitment to military-grade testing standards is reflected in every VP9 unit. Its modular grip system, ambidextrous design, and exceptional trigger immediately set it apart in a competitive market crowded with polymer pistols.

Since its release, the VP9 has built a strong following among professionals and civilians alike. Whether for home defense, range training, or duty use, it embodies HK’s signature traits: precision engineering, flawless function, and ergonomics that adapt to the shooter.

What are the specifications of the H&K VP9?

Core Technical Data

  • Caliber: 9×19mm Parabellum (9mm Luger)

  • Action type: Striker-fired

  • Barrel length: 4.09 inches (104 mm)

  • Overall length: 7.34 inches (186.5 mm)

  • Height: 5.41 inches (137.5 mm)

  • Width: 1.32 inches (33.5 mm)

  • Weight (unloaded): 25.56 oz (725 g)

  • Magazine capacity: 17 rounds (standard)

  • Frame material: Polymer

  • Slide material: Steel with corrosion-resistant coating

  • Barrel: Cold hammer-forged with polygonal rifling

  • Sights: 3-dot metal or night sights (adjustable, suppressor-height available)

  • Accessory rail: Picatinny MIL-STD-1913 for lights and lasers

  • Manufacturer: Heckler & Koch GmbH, Germany (HK USA for U.S. market)

  • Year introduced: 2014

The VP9 is often compared to the Glock 17 in size and role, but it stands out for its refined ergonomics, ambidextrous controls, and enhanced trigger system.

How is the H&K VP9 designed and built?

Frame and Slide Construction

The VP9 combines HK’s combat durability with a lightweight polymer frame and precision-machined steel slide treated with a nitro-carburized finish. The slide serrations—both front and rear—provide a confident grip, even under stress or with gloves. The cold hammer-forged polygonal barrel not only improves accuracy but also extends barrel life and makes cleaning easier.

Ergonomics and Grip Design

Ergonomics are where the VP9 truly excels. Borrowing from the P30’s modular system, it features interchangeable backstraps and side panels, creating over 20 possible combinations. This allows users to fine-tune grip circumference and contour to their exact hand shape.

The grip angle promotes a natural point of aim, while the mild stippling and finger grooves enhance comfort. Many shooters describe it as one of the best-feeling polymer pistols on the market.

Controls and Safety Features

The VP9 features fully ambidextrous controls: dual slide stop levers, a paddle-style magazine release, and internal safeties including a striker block and trigger safety. The absence of an external manual safety keeps the design streamlined, though HK’s engineering ensures drop safety and consistent trigger reliability.

Accessory Compatibility

The Picatinny rail supports compact lights and lasers. Optics-ready variants (VP9 OR and Tactical OR) include slide cuts for red dot mounting, making the platform future-proof for modern defensive and duty applications.

What are the key variants of the H&K VP9 and how do they differ?

VP9 (Standard)

The standard VP9 is the base model, offering the full 4.09-inch barrel and 17-round capacity. It’s ideal for duty and range use, balancing size and control.

VP9SK (Subcompact)

The VP9SK shortens both the barrel and grip for concealed carry, while retaining the same grip customization and ergonomics. It’s compatible with full-size VP9 magazines using grip sleeves.

VP9 Tactical OR

This model adds a threaded barrel for suppressor use and is optics-ready, accommodating popular red dot footprints. It’s designed for professional and tactical users who want advanced configuration options.

VP9 A1 Series

The updated A1 models feature enhanced slide serrations and revised magazine capacities, improving handling and loadout flexibility.

Comparable Pistols

Comparable models include the Glock 17, SIG Sauer P320, and Walther PDP. While Glock dominates for simplicity and cost, many shooters prefer the VP9 for its out-of-the-box trigger and superior ergonomics. The Walther PDP rivals it in feel but can’t match HK’s precision build and recoil system.

 

How does the H&K VP9 perform in real-world testing?

Accuracy

The VP9 delivers exceptional accuracy thanks to its cold hammer-forged barrel and excellent sight alignment. Shooters routinely report 2-inch groups at 25 yards with factory ammunition. The trigger’s clean break and short reset aid precision and follow-up shot speed.

Recoil Management and Control

Recoil is mild and linear. The pistol’s weight distribution and grip design help manage muzzle rise, even during rapid fire. The slightly higher bore axis compared to the Glock 17 does introduce minimal muzzle flip, but most users report it’s barely noticeable.

Reliability

Reliability is nearly flawless. Extensive range reports and user tests confirm the VP9 runs smoothly through thousands of rounds with no malfunctions, even across varied ammunition types—including +P loads and steel-cased rounds.

Trigger Quality

The VP9 trigger is widely regarded as one of the best factory striker triggers on the market. It offers minimal take-up, a crisp break around 5 pounds, and an audible, tactile reset. This consistency makes it suitable for both duty and competition use.

What ammunition works best in the H&K VP9?

Recommended Loads

  • 115gr–147gr 9mm perform flawlessly across brands

  • Handles +P and +P+ ammunition with ease

Defensive Ammunition

  • Speer Gold Dot 124gr +P

  • Federal HST 124gr or 147gr

  • Hornady Critical Duty 135gr +P

Training Ammunition

  • Blazer Brass 115gr FMJ

  • Winchester White Box 124gr

  • Fiocchi or Magtech standard-pressure loads

The VP9’s polygonal rifling ensures smooth feeding and enhanced velocity. It digests virtually any 9mm load with minimal fouling or extraction issues.

How well does the H&K VP9 fit different use cases?

Is the H&K VP9 good for concealed or self-defense carry?

While the full-size VP9 may be large for deep concealment, its balance and ergonomics make it suitable for OWB or larger IWB carry setups. The VP9SK is the better choice for everyday concealed carry, retaining the same control layout in a smaller frame.

Is the H&K VP9 suitable for home defense?

Absolutely. Its 17-round capacity, light rail for weapon lights, and intuitive striker-fired trigger make it one of the best home defense pistols available. The VP9 Tactical OR’s red dot compatibility further enhances its defensive readiness.

Is the H&K VP9 viable for competition shooting?

Yes. The VP9’s crisp trigger, fast reset, and superior accuracy make it ideal for IDPA, USPSA, or 3-Gun matches. The VP9 Tactical and A1 models, in particular, provide the configuration flexibility needed for competitive environments.

Does the H&K VP9 serve as a professional-duty firearm?

It’s built for it. Many European law enforcement agencies issue the VP9 (designated SFP9 in Europe), citing its reliability and safety features. Its ambidextrous controls make it accessible for all officers regardless of handedness.

Is the H&K VP9 a good range pistol?

The VP9 is often praised as one of the most enjoyable range guns available. Its consistent accuracy and low recoil make it a top choice for extended shooting sessions or new shooters learning fundamentals.

What are the pros and cons of the H&K VP9?

Pros

  • Exceptional ergonomics with fully customizable grip

  • One of the best striker-fired triggers in its class

  • Reliable operation across all ammo types

  • Fully ambidextrous controls

  • Superb accuracy and barrel longevity

  • Available in optics-ready and tactical models

  • HK’s premium construction and corrosion resistance

Cons

  • Higher price point than many competitors

  • Slightly higher bore axis than Glock or P320

  • Paddle-style mag release requires training for some users

  • Not ideal for deep concealment (full-size)
